About the Department
As one of the first schools of social work in the United States, the
Crown Family School of Social Work, Policy, and Practice has shaped the
field for more than 100 years. As part of the University of Chicago, the
Crown Family School shares the University\'s core values and distinctive
intellectual culture. Crown Family School faculty, staff and students
focus on identifying solutions to complex problems affecting society\'s
most marginalized individuals and communities through the integration of
research, training, and direct community engagement. Guided by an
interdisciplinary tradition, Crown Family School scholars conduct
innovative research to address interconnected social challenges such as
educational inequality, health disparities, crime and violence, poverty,
and child and family welfare-working at multiple scales, from individual
to policy-level interventions. The Crown Family School is the home of
several academic centers. These include the Susan and Richard Kiphart
Center for Global Health and Social Development, the Urban Education
Institute (UEI), the Chicago Center for Youth Violence Prevention, the
Center for Health Administration Studies, the Smart Decarceration
Project, the Employment Instability, Family Well-being, and Social
Policy Network (EINet), and the Network for College Success.
Today, our work has never been more important. More than 8,000 Crown
Family School graduates in the US and globally hold leadership positions
in academia, at nonprofits, and at governmental agencies - committed to
create a more just and more humane society through principles of
inclusion, equity, and diversity.
Job Summary
The Director of Human Resources and Faculty Affairs is responsible for
the overall strategic direction, planning, coordination, administration
and evaluation of the staff and academic human resources functions at
The Crown Family School of Social Work, Practice, & Policy. The role
manages a team of professional staff responsible for designing,
implementing, and monitoring HR programs to address long-term human
resource needs and trends.
